Microservice performance simulation test based on Kubemark

Abstract: Virtualization technology has greatly accelerated the expansion of applications on the microservice architecture. As the complexity of these applications continues to increase, microservice performance may be significantly different from the expected. Therefore, the methods and evaluation criteria of microservice performance testing have become a topic that scholars have begun to explore. This paper draws on the testing methods and evaluation standards of Web service quality, and uses the simulation testing methods in the experiments. The Kubemark tool is used to test the performance of the microservice system on the Kubernetes platform, and the p-percentile indicator in RFC 2679 standard is used to analyze the results. Experimental results show that the performance of microservices is significantly affected by the type of load microservices, and simulation testing is an effective research method for microservices performance testing.
